#54f843 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54f843 is composed of 32.9% red, 97.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 73%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 114.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 61.8%. #54f843 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ff86 with #00f100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#54f843 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54f843 has RGB values of R:84, G:248,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 5568579.

Shades and Tints of #54f843
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effeed is the lightest one.

Tones of #54f843
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9e9d is the less saturated color, while #54f843 is the most saturated one.
